Accura Healthcare of Newton East, LLC
Accura Healthcare of Newton East, LLC is a 54-bed nursing home in Newton, Iowa. CMS has certified it for Medicare and Medicaid since 2000-12-01. It averages 49.3 residents a day.
What harm was found in the violations cited at Accura Healthcare of Newton East, LLC?
CMS lists 39 health-inspection deficiencies for Accura Healthcare of Newton East, LLC, all of them in the three years to 2026-08-01: the highest scope-and-severity letter on record is J; the most recent health inspection was 2026-02-18.

How is Accura Healthcare of Newton East, LLC staffed relative to the IA average?
| Measure | This facility | IA average |
|---|---|---|
| Total nurse staffing hours per resident per day | 3.13611 | 3.81506 |
| Total nursing staff turnover (%) | 38.2 | 44.0 |
| Average number of residents per day | 49.3 | 52.4 |
Who owns Accura Healthcare of Newton East, LLC, and what chain is it in?
Accura Healthcare of Newton East, LLC is registered with CMS as For profit - Limited Liability company, operates under the legal business name NEWTON CARE LLC and belongs to the ACCURA HEALTHCARE chain.
